Oracle数据库基础与实验指南
需积分: 10 136 浏览量
更新于2024-10-13
收藏 2.7MB PDF 举报
"Oracle数据库应用试验指导书.pdf"
Oracle数据库是全球广泛使用的大型关系型数据库管理系统,它提供了高效、稳定的数据存储和管理能力。本试验指导书主要关注Oracle数据库的常用命令和概念,以及如何通过不同的工具进行操作。
一、系统全局区(SGA)
系统全局区(System Global Area)是Oracle数据库核心的组成部分,它是一块共享的内存区域,用于存储数据库实例的各种关键数据。SGA包含了以下几个关键部分:
1. 数据库高速缓冲区(Database Buffer Cache):这是SGA中最大的部分,用于存放从磁盘读取的数据块,目的是减少I/O操作,提高数据访问速度。当数据被修改时,会首先在缓冲区中进行,然后在合适的时间写回磁盘。
2. 共享存储区(Shared Pool):这个区域存储了解析后的SQL语句、PL/SQL代码和数据库的内存对象,如数据字典缓存,以供多个用户共享,减少重复解析的工作。
3. 重做日志存储缓冲区(Redo Log Buffer):存储对数据库所做的事务更改,确保在系统崩溃时可以通过重做日志恢复数据。
4. JAVA存储区(Java Pool):用于支持Oracle的内置Java虚拟机,处理与Java相关的数据库操作。
5. 大型存储区(Large Pool):主要用于Oracle的RMAN备份、大对象(LOB)操作和并行服务器进程等。
SGA的总容量等于这些组件之和,管理员可以根据系统的性能需求调整各个部分的大小。
二、试验内容
在实验环节,学生将接触到以下工具:
1. Oracle企业管理器(OEM):一个全面的数据库管理和监控工具,允许用户管理数据库、执行性能分析、监控数据库状态等。
2. iSQL*PLUS:一个基于Web的数据库查询和管理工具,提供交互式SQL执行环境。
3. SQL*PLUS:Oracle的标准命令行工具,可以执行SQL查询、PL/SQL程序,以及数据库管理和维护任务。
4. 数据库配置助手(DBCA):图形化的数据库创建和管理工具,简化了数据库实例的配置过程。
通过以上试验内容,学生可以深入理解Oracle数据库的工作原理,掌握基本的数据库管理和操作技能,为后续的数据库应用打下坚实基础。在实验过程中,应重点关注SGA的管理,了解如何优化其组件以提升数据库性能,同时熟练运用各种工具进行数据库操作。
点击了解资源详情
点击了解资源详情
点击了解资源详情
kt431128
- 粉丝: 1
- 资源: 7
最新资源
- 深入浅出:自定义 Grunt 任务的实践指南
- 网络物理突变工具的多点路径规划实现与分析
- multifeed: 实现多作者间的超核心共享与同步技术
- C++商品交易系统实习项目详细要求
- macOS系统Python模块whl包安装教程
- 掌握fullstackJS:构建React框架与快速开发应用
- React-Purify: 实现React组件纯净方法的工具介绍
- deck.js:构建现代HTML演示的JavaScript库
- nunn:现代C++17实现的机器学习库开源项目
- Python安装包 Acquisition-4.12-cp35-cp35m-win_amd64.whl.zip 使用说明
- Amaranthus-tuberculatus基因组分析脚本集
- Ubuntu 12.04下Realtek RTL8821AE驱动的向后移植指南
- 掌握Jest环境下的最新jsdom功能
- CAGI Toolkit:开源Asterisk PBX的AGI应用开发
- MyDropDemo: 体验QGraphicsView的拖放功能
- 远程FPGA平台上的Quartus II17.1 LCD色块闪烁现象解析